Responsibilities

  • Perform field inspections for transportation construction projects
  • Inspect installation of: Traffic signals, Roadway lighting, Conduit systems, Fiber optic systems, Electrical pull boxes and foundations, Signal poles and mast arms
  • Verify contractor work complies with: Approved plans and specifications, MUTCD standards, Local and state transportation requirements
  • Document daily inspection reports and project activities
  • Coordinate with contractors, utility providers, and project stakeholders
  • Review traffic control implementation and safety compliance
  • Monitor construction schedules and identify potential issues
  • Assist with punch list development and project closeout
  • Attend project meetings and provide status updates
